How Mattress Ventilation Improves Hygiene
Ventilation plays a significant role in controlling moisture accumulation. A well ventilated mattress dries faster and prevents the growth of mold or allergens. The breathable fabric in RichSleep mattresses encourages airflow and maintains a fresh sleep surface. Improved ventilation also reduces heat retention which indirectly supports hygiene by preventing the warm and moist conditions in which microbes typically grow.
